Έκδοση Pandas Check

Ekdose Pandas Check



Το 'Pandas' είναι μια βιβλιοθήκη 'Python' ανοιχτού κώδικα. Χρησιμοποιείται για την αξιολόγηση των δεδομένων. Η έκδοση αναπτύσσεται κάθε χρόνο. Μερικές φορές, νωρίτερα, οι αλλαγές και οι ενημερώσεις πραγματοποιούνται συνεχώς. Μερικές φορές, είναι πολύ σημαντικό να γνωρίζουμε την έκδοση που χρησιμοποιούμε στην εγκατεστημένη βιβλιοθήκη Pandas. Για παράδειγμα, αν το εγκαταστήσουμε πριν από ένα χρόνο, δεν θα είναι της ίδιας έκδοσης όπως όταν το εγκαταστήσαμε. Θα είχε ενημερωθεί μία φορά σίγουρα και ίσως δύο φορές υπάρχει πιθανότητα. Λοιπόν, πώς θα αναγνωρίσουμε την ακριβή έκδοση που χρησιμοποιείται αυτήν τη στιγμή;

Για αυτό, τα Panda έρχονται με μια λειτουργία που διευκολύνει τον οποιονδήποτε να τη χρησιμοποιήσει για να γνωρίζει την έκδοση που χρησιμοποιείται. Λειτουργεί για χρήστες Linux, Windows και χρήστες Mac επίσης. Θα συζητήσουμε όλους τους πιθανούς τρόπους με τους οποίους μπορούμε να εκτελέσουμε τον έλεγχο της «έκδοσης Pandas». Για την υλοποίηση του κώδικα, θα χρησιμοποιήσουμε το λογισμικό “Spyder” καθώς είναι ένα φιλικό λογισμικό βασισμένο στη γλώσσα Python για την εκτέλεση του κώδικα.







Σύνταξη:

' PD.__έκδοση__'


Η παρεχόμενη σύνταξη χρησιμοποιείται για τον έλεγχο της έκδοσης των Panda. Το 'pd' στον κώδικα είναι για το 'Pandas', που σημαίνει την εισαγωγή της βιβλιοθήκης Pandas ως 'pd'. Είναι μια απλή προσέγγιση για να ελέγξουμε την έκδοση που χρησιμοποιείται κάθε φορά που χρειάζεται να γνωρίζουμε την έκδοση που χρησιμοποιούμε. Εκτελέστε τον κωδικό και θα ενημερωθούμε για την έκδοση. Είναι πολύ γρήγορο και απλό.



Γιατί και πώς να χρησιμοποιήσετε την έκδοση Pandas Check

Στις μεγάλες εταιρείες, η απόδοση της ανάλυσης δεδομένων είναι δύσκολη και από καιρό σε καιρό συμβαίνουν τα νέα προς νέα προβλήματα για τα οποία οι λύσεις ποικίλλουν και χτυπούν με τον καιρό. Όταν τα δεδομένα είναι μεγάλα, χρειαζόμαστε τις τεχνικές επίλυσης προβλημάτων σε κάθε σημείο. Η ενημέρωση ορισμένων από αυτά πραγματοποιείται με τη γνώση της διαδικασίας, πράγμα που σημαίνει ότι υπάρχουν κάποια κριτήρια για την ενημέρωση που μπορεί να είναι κάθε είδους υλικό μνήμης ή άλλες απαιτήσεις. Αφού εκπληρώσουμε την απαίτηση, πραγματοποιείται η ενημέρωση και αυτό φαίνεται σε εμάς όταν χρησιμοποιούμε την έκδοση ελέγχου Pandas. Εμφανίζεται η ενημερωμένη έκδοση. Διαφορετικά, μπορείτε να δείτε την προηγούμενη έκδοση. Θα σας ενημερώσουμε και θα το ενημερώσουμε αναλόγως.



Ακολουθούν οι μέθοδοι που μπορούν να χρησιμοποιηθούν για την εκτέλεση του ελέγχου της έκδοσης στα Pandas των «pandas». Θα τα εξετάσουμε ένα προς ένα με παραδείγματα για σαφή κατανόηση και εφαρμογή των παρακάτω:





    • Χρησιμοποιήστε το χαρακτηριστικό 'version' για να ελέγξετε την έκδοση του Panda.
    • Ελέγξτε την 'έκδοση' του Panda με τις εξαρτήσεις.
    • Ελέγξτε την 'έκδοση' του Panda με τις εξαρτήσεις χρησιμοποιώντας τη μορφή JSON.

Παράδειγμα 1: Χρήση του χαρακτηριστικού έκδοσης για έλεγχο της έκδοσης Pandas

Σε αυτό το παράδειγμα, θα χρησιμοποιήσουμε τον πιο εύκολο τρόπο για να ελέγξουμε την έκδοση Pandas που τρέχει στο σύστημά μας. Αρχικά, ανοίξτε το εργαλείο 'Spyder' στον επιτραπέζιο/φορητό υπολογιστή σας καθώς θα εκτελέσουμε τον κώδικα σε αυτό. Στη συνέχεια, εισαγάγετε τη βιβλιοθήκη Pandas για να εργαστεί στο περιβάλλον Python και για τη λειτουργική απαίτηση του ελέγχου έκδοσης. Μπορούμε να λάβουμε τον έλεγχο αριθμού έκδοσης χρησιμοποιώντας το χαρακτηριστικό '__version__' των Pandas. Η έκδοση είναι με τις τέσσερις παύλες – δύο παύλες στην αρχή και δύο παύλες μετά το χαρακτηριστικό version.

Η έκδοση είναι μια ενσωματωμένη συνάρτηση που παρέχεται από τα Panda για να επιστρέψει τον αριθμό που καθορίζει την έκδοση των Panda που είναι εγκατεστημένη. Στη συνέχεια, εκτυπώστε το 'pd' με 'dot' και με το χαρακτηριστικό. Εδώ, πηγαίνουμε με τις παρεχόμενες γνώσεις ελέγχου έκδοσης. Η έκδοση που εμφανίζεται είναι πάντα η ενημερωμένη έκδοση που είναι εγκατεστημένη στο περιβάλλον εργασίας σας.




Εδώ, η έξοδος εμφανίζει τη σωστή έκδοση που εκτελείται αυτήν τη στιγμή στην επιφάνεια εργασίας σας. Είναι εύκολο να ελέγξετε την έκδοση Pandas χρησιμοποιώντας τη λειτουργία Pandas. Υπάρχει ένα κόλπο εδώ: στην αρχή, όταν εγκαθιστούμε οποιοδήποτε λογισμικό της 'Python oriented language' για τη χρήση των συναρτήσεων Pandas για να ελέγξουμε ότι η έκδοση Pandas είναι εγκατεστημένη ή όχι, μπορούμε να κάνουμε τον ίδιο έλεγχο έκδοσης που διασφαλίζει ότι η διαδικασία εγκατάστασης γίνεται με τις βιβλιοθήκες Pandas.

Παράδειγμα 2: Έλεγχος της έκδοσης Pandas με τις Εξαρτήσεις

Στο προηγούμενο παράδειγμα που κάναμε τον έλεγχο έκδοσης του Pandas, εμφανίζει μόνο τον αριθμό έκδοσης που έχει εγκατασταθεί. Τι γίνεται αν πρέπει να μάθουμε κάπως για τις εξαρτήσεις και τις περιπτώσεις που εμπλέκονται; Μπορούμε να το ελέγξουμε από τη συνάρτηση Pandas. Ας δούμε πώς να το κάνουμε αυτό. Εισαγάγετε τη βιβλιοθήκη των Pandas αφού είναι απαραίτητο.

Τώρα, η συνάρτηση βοηθητικού προγράμματος είναι 'and', 'dot' και η μέθοδος 'show_version'. Η έκδοση εκπομπής μπορεί όχι μόνο να δώσει τις πληροφορίες για την έκδοση του Panda αλλά παρέχει επίσης τις πλήρεις λεπτομέρειες σχετικά με τα εξαρτημένα πακέτα του Panda. Η έκδοση της Python και ο τύπος του λειτουργικού συστήματος εγκαθίστανται και χρησιμοποιούνται σε ένα από αυτά.


Η έξοδος εμφανίζει τις πληροφορίες λεπτομερώς για κάθε έκδοση του Panda, τις άλλες εκδόσεις που χρησιμοποιείτε, καθώς και τις πληροφορίες του λειτουργικού συστήματος φιλοξενίας.

Παράδειγμα 3: Έλεγχος της έκδοσης Pandas με τις εξαρτήσεις χρησιμοποιώντας τη μορφή JSON

Μάθαμε πώς να ελέγχουμε την έκδοση Pandas και πώς να ελέγχουμε τις εξαρτήσεις της. Εδώ, σε αυτό το παράδειγμα, θα ελέγξουμε την έκδοση Pandas ανάλογα, αλλά τώρα θα το κάνουμε χρησιμοποιώντας το 'JSON'. Είναι ένα όρισμα που χρησιμοποιείται στα Pandas και έχει οριστεί από προεπιλογή ως ψευδές. Στο προηγούμενο παράδειγμα, υπήρχε JSON αλλά το γεγονός ότι 'δεν ήταν ορατό', η ρύθμιση της προεπιλογής είναι εκεί. Όταν πρέπει να αλλάξουμε το όρισμα, πρέπει να το κάνουμε ορατό και να αλλάξουμε τον Boolean όρο σε 'true' για να αλλάξουμε την προεπιλεγμένη ρύθμιση. Γιατί προκύπτει το ερώτημα JSON; Το JSON είναι μια ανοιχτή τυπική μορφή αρχείου και είναι ένας εύκολος τρόπος ανάγνωσης των δεδομένων λόγω της διαχείρισης των δεδομένων και της παρουσίασης. Η μορφή 'JSON' υποδηλώνει τη μορφή σημειογραφίας αντικειμένου JavaScript. Αυτό ανταλλάσσει τη μορφή σε τυπικά δεδομένα. Το Pandas JSON μετατρέπει μια λίστα σε DataFrame που φαίνεται πολύ πιο τακτοποιημένο και οργανωμένο.


Η οθόνη εμφανίζει όλες τις εξαρτήσεις της έκδοσης Pandas μετά από έλεγχο. Όπως βλέπουμε, τα δεδομένα επιστρέφονται σε μορφή 'JSON'. Τα δεδομένα γίνονται ευανάγνωστα.

συμπέρασμα

Ο έλεγχος έκδοσης του Panda είναι μια τόσο χρήσιμη και χρήσιμη λειτουργία. Μερικές φορές, είναι σημαντικό να γνωρίζουμε την έκδοση που χρησιμοποιούμε για να εργαστούμε. Αντί να περνάμε από πολλές εντολές και ρυθμίσεις λειτουργιών, μπορούμε να χρησιμοποιήσουμε τη λειτουργία ελέγχου έκδοσης Pandas για να μας ενημερώσετε για την έκδοση, καθώς είναι επίσης πολύ εύκολο να το κάνουμε. Κάναμε όλες τις πιθανές μεθόδους της έκδοσης ελέγχου Pandas που εκτελέστηκαν στα παραδείγματα. Κάναμε τον έλεγχο έκδοσης χρησιμοποιώντας τα Panda. Έχουμε κάνει τον έλεγχο έκδοσης στα Panda με όλες τις εξαρτήσεις τους. Τέλος, κάναμε τον έλεγχο έκδοσης στο Pandas για όλες τις εξαρτήσεις αλλάζοντας το όρισμα και για να λάβουμε τα αποτελέσματα σε μορφή 'JSON'. Όλες αυτές οι τεχνικές είναι εξαιρετικές για να σας ενημερώσουν για την εγκατεστημένη έκδοση του Panda. Όλα μπορούν να χρησιμοποιηθούν σε διαφορετικές καταστάσεις ανάλογα με τις απαιτήσεις. Η έκδοση Pandas check είναι ο πιο γρήγορος τρόπος για να γνωρίζετε την έκδοση χωρίς κόπο.